Does the Geekom A7 Max run Linux well? In this video, I take a close look at the Geekom A7 Max mini PC with a strong focus on Linux compatibility, hardware support, and overall value for Linux users.

I walk through the build quality, ports, and specifications, then dive into real-world Linux testing to see how well this system handles modern Linux distributions. If you’re considering the Geekom A7 Max as a Linux mini PC for daily use, development, or home lab tasks, this review will help you decide if it’s the right fit.

I’ll also discuss pricing and value to determine whether the Geekom A7 Max makes sense compared to other mini PCs on the market—especially if Linux is your operating system of choice.

If you’re researching Linux on mini PCs, looking for a quiet, compact Linux system, or wondering whether AMD-based mini PCs offer good Linux support, this video is for you!
